iOS视角:网站框架优选与高效设计实战全攻略
|
在iOS开发中,网站框架的选择对项目的成功至关重要。一个优秀的框架不仅能提升开发效率,还能确保应用的稳定性与可维护性。常见的iOS网站框架包括SwiftUI、UIKit以及第三方框架如React Native和Flutter。选择合适的框架需结合项目需求、团队技能和未来扩展性。
插画AI辅助完成,仅供参考 SwiftUI是苹果官方推出的声明式框架,适合构建原生iOS应用。它的语法简洁,界面更新直观,能够快速实现动态UI。对于希望深度集成苹果生态系统的项目来说,SwiftUI是一个理想选择。 UIKit作为传统的框架,仍然广泛使用,尤其适用于需要高度定制化或兼容旧版本iOS的应用。虽然学习曲线较陡,但其成熟度和社区支持使其在许多企业级项目中依然占有一席之地。 对于需要跨平台能力的项目,React Native和Flutter提供了高效的解决方案。它们允许开发者用一套代码同时构建iOS和Android应用,节省大量时间和资源。然而,这些框架在某些复杂交互或性能敏感场景下可能不如原生框架表现优异。 高效设计的关键在于合理规划架构。采用模块化设计可以提高代码复用率,降低耦合度。同时,遵循MVC或MVVM模式有助于保持代码清晰,便于后期维护和团队协作。 在实际开发中,应注重性能优化,例如减少不必要的视图渲染、合理管理内存和网络请求。测试也是不可忽视的一环,单元测试和UI测试能有效提升应用质量。 站长个人见解,选择合适的框架并结合良好的设计实践,是打造高性能、易维护iOS应用的基础。开发者需根据项目特点灵活决策,不断优化开发流程。 (编辑:草根网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|


浙公网安备 33038102330470号